How do I give permission to a folder in Ubuntu?
Type “sudo chmod a+rwx /path/to/file” into the terminal, replacing “/path/to/file” with the file you want to give permissions to everyone for, and press “Enter.” You can also use the command “sudo chmod -R a+rwx /path/to/folder” to give permissions to the selected folder and its files.

How do I give a full permission to a shared folder in Linux?
Run sudo adduser $USER vboxsf from terminal. To take effect you should log out and then log in, or you may need to reboot. Edit the file /etc/group (you will need root privileges). Look for the line vboxsf:x:999 and add at the end :yourusername — use this solution if you don’t have sudo.

What does chmod 777 mean?
Setting 777 permissions to a file or directory means that it will be readable, writable and executable by all users and may pose a huge security risk. File ownership can be changed using the chown command and permissions with the chmod command.

How do I access a shared folder in Linux?
Access a Windows shared folder from Linux, using Nautilus
- Open Nautilus.
- From the File menu, select Connect to Server.
- In the Service type drop-down box, select Windows share.
- In the Server field, enter the name of your computer.
- Click Connect.
